adjective
A2
property
1
Essential or needed
Something you must have or do; very important and needed.
用法模式:
it is necessary to [verb]
常见错误:
Learners sometimes confuse 'necessary' with 'needed'. While similar, 'necessary' often sounds more formal and is used in fixed expressions like 'it is necessary to...'.

名词
formal
B1
entity
2
An essential thing or condition
Something you must have or cannot live without.
常见错误:
Some learners confuse 'necessity' with 'necessary'. The former is a noun, the latter an adjective.

相关表达
if necessary
1/ˈɪf nˈɛsɪsˌɛɹi/
fixed phrase
Only if it is needed
Used to say that something will be done only if it is needed.
例句
- We can meet earlier if necessary.
- If necessary, I will drive you myself.
